2.3.6 Switching the vehicle on
For safety reasons, the driver's
seat is equipped with a seat
contact switch. The vehicle can
only be started when the oper-
ator is sitting on the driver's
seat.
1. Pull the power plug (Fig. 13/1) from
the socket and place it in the holding
recess.
2. All control levers must be in their
neutral position.
3. Switch on the vehicle with the key
switch (Fig. 13/3) and set the re-
quired direction using the driving di-
rection selection switch (Fig. 13/5).
The operating hour counter
(Fig. 13/4) displays the software ver-
sion, the last service code (if applica-
ble) and operating hours in
succession. Service code table, refer
to Section 2.4.
